Thushika Kularathne

Thushika has spent the past 10 years navigating high-pressure environments, from ortho trauma wards and oncology units, to busy classrooms filled with curious, energetic students.

These experiences taught her a simple but powerful truth: real learning goes beyond facts and procedures. It’s about adapting, reflecting, and understanding the world around us.

As a registered nurse, Thushika worked across specialties including orthopedics, neurology, rehabilitation, mental health, and even prison healthcare, gaining experience in complex situations and learning to stay calm, observant, and solution-focused. As a primary school teacher, she has taught classroom subjects alongside visual and performing arts and physical education, nurturing creativity, curiosity, and confidence in young learners.

She holds a Bachelor of Nursing and a Master of Teaching, combining deep practical insight with educational expertise.

Driven by a passion for making a real impact in society, Thushika founded Holara Education to help students create the foundations for change.
